NewsFlash: Social media discriminates against people with sensory disabilities

Social networking sites like Facebook and Twitter are effectively “locking users out” by not providing accessibility.  but due to the nature of their site, they’re getting away with it. Should social media sites have to comply with accessibility legislation?  See article
